In theatre, it often happens that the intensity of a licht channel is not right from the first time. For example it is 80%, but it should be 90%.. We try that out, it seems ok, and then the director says "ok, that should be 90% for every cue where it was 80%". That is not to much work with a bit of cut and paste, but it would be very easy to have a CLI command like

q1.1-25.3c8=90%

saying "from que 1.1 to 25.3 set channel 8 to 90%".

It would be a bit impractical and dangerous to read all cues to your computer, modify channel 8 in all cues, and write it back to the box. But..


How about just setting the master intensity of channel 8 to 110%?

More solutions:

For any loaded cue you can always correct one or more channels, by typing e.g. +10 you raise the DMX value by 10.

You can modify a channel or selection of channels in the cuelist editor by using the wheel on the control panel, but most people do not know that if you select a range of cells (say channel 8 in all steps), and you change the wheel (or type a new DMX value) -all- cells will be changed! So changing your 80% to 90% can be done very quickly.

Also in this case typing +10 means add 10 to previous value (and yes, -10 means subtract 10 ;-)
